General Description
The Fairchild Switch FSTD16244 provides 16-bits of highspeed CMOS TTL-compatible bus switching. The low On Resistance of the switch allows inputs to be connected to outputs without adding propagation delay or generating additional ground bounce noise. A diode to VCC has been integrated into the circuit to allow for level shifting between 5V inputs and 3.3V outputs. The device is organized as a 16-bit switch. There are four 4-bit switches with separate output enable inputs. When OE is LOW, the switch in ON and Port A is connected to Port B. When OE is HIGH, the switch OFF and a high impedance state exists between the A and B Ports.
Features
I 4Ω switch connection between two ports. I Minimal propagation delay through the switch. I Low lCC. I Zero bounce in flow-through mode. I Control inputs compatible with TTL level. I TruTranslation voltage translation from 5.0V inputs to 3.3V outputs
